P060B 2013 Toyota RAV4 Code - Internal Control Module A/D Processing Performance
Quick Answer
The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) will be set when the Engine Control Module (ECM) Internal Analog/Digital (A/D) conversion processing system is malfunctioning. Common causes include Faulty Engine Control Module (ECM), Engine Control Module harness is open or shorted, Engine Control Module circuit poor electrical connection. Severity is High - diagnose this code as soon as possible. Driving is not recommended if the warning light is flashing, the engine runs poorly, or safety-related symptoms are present.

Code P060B 2013 Toyota RAV4 Description
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P060B 2013 Toyota RAV4?
- Faulty Engine Control Module (ECM)
- Engine Control Module harness is open or shorted
- Engine Control Module circuit poor electrical connection
How to Fix the DTC P060B 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

Frequently Asked Questions about P060B 2013 Toyota RAV4 Code
What does the OBDII code P060B mean for a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Code P060B indicates an issue with the Internal Control Module's A/D (Analog to Digital) Processing Performance, suggesting a malfunction in how the module processes data.
What are the common symptoms of code P060B in a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Symptoms may include poor engine performance, erratic shifting, reduced fuel efficiency, illuminated check engine light, and occasional stalling.
What causes the P060B code in a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Common causes include a faulty Engine Control Module (ECM), wiring or connection issues, software glitches in the ECM, or electrical interference from other components.
Can I drive my 2013 Toyota RAV4 with the P060B code?
Driving with the P060B code may be possible, but it is not recommended as it could lead to further engine or transmission issues and decreased performance.
How is code P060B diagnosed on a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
A mechanic uses a diagnostic scanner to confirm the code, inspects wiring and connectors, checks ECM performance, and may test the vehicle's sensors for proper operation.
What repairs are needed to fix the P060B code on a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Repairs may involve replacing or reprogramming the ECM, fixing damaged wiring or connectors, or addressing issues with related sensors.
Can a software update fix the P060B code in a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Yes, if the issue is related to an ECM software glitch, a software update or reprogramming may resolve the problem.
How much does it cost to repair the P060B code on a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Costs can vary, but ECM replacement or reprogramming typically ranges from $300 to $1,000, including parts and labor.
Could a dead battery cause the P060B code in a 2013 Toyota RAV4?
Yes, a weak or dead battery can cause voltage issues that may trigger the P060B code due to improper ECM operation.
Should I clear the P060B code on my 2013 Toyota RAV4 without repairing it?
Clearing the code without addressing the underlying issue may result in the problem reoccurring and potential damage to the vehicle's systems.
